Why Integrate CryptoPro and GitLab?
Integrating CryptoPro and GitLab offers exciting opportunities for enhancing security and streamlining development workflows. CryptoPro is well-known for its cryptographic solutions, including digital signatures and encryption, while GitLab facilitates collaborative code development and version control. Together, they can significantly improve the way organizations manage their code and ensure its integrity.
Here are some key benefits of using CryptoPro in conjunction with GitLab:
- Enhanced Security: By employing CryptoPro's cryptographic capabilities, users can ensure that code changes and commits in GitLab are digitally signed, providing proof of origin and preventing unauthorized modifications.
- Compliance: Many industries require regulatory compliance that mandates strong security practices. Integrating CryptoPro with GitLab helps organizations meet these requirements more effectively.
- Streamlined Workflows: Automating the signing process for commits and merges can significantly decrease the time developers spend on manual tasks, allowing for more focus on coding and innovation.
- Improved Collaboration: Teams can work together more confidently, knowing that all code contributions are securely signed and verifiable, fostering a culture of trust.

Most Powerful Ways To Connect CryptoPro and GitLab?
Connecting CryptoPro and GitLab can significantly enhance your workflow, especially if you are focused on security and version control in your development environment. Here are three of the most powerful ways to establish this connection:
-
API Integrations:
Both CryptoPro and GitLab offer robust APIs that can be leveraged to create custom integrations. By utilizing the APIs, you can automate tasks such as signing commits or documents with CryptoPro, ensuring that any version of your code or documentation is securely signed and verifiable. This not only enhances security but also streamlines your audit processes.
-
Webhooks:
Setting up webhooks in GitLab allows you to trigger specific actions in CryptoPro in response to events in your GitLab repositories. For example, you can create a webhook that sends a request to CryptoPro whenever a new commit is pushed, automatically signing and validating the commit before further actions are taken. This approach helps to maintain a secure chain of custody for your code.
